Compsolechia refracta is a moth of the Gelechiidae family. It was described by Meyrick in 1914. It is found in Guyana, Peru and Brazil.
The wingspan is 12-13 mm. The forewings are dark brown with four very obscure violet-fuscous direct transverse fasciae, the first moderate and subbasal, the second broad and antemedian, the third very broad and postmedian and the fourth from four-fifths of the costa to the tornus, sometimes slightly incurved, narrow and posteriorly suffused. There is a small obscure spot of ground colour in the third representing the second discal stigma. The hindwings are dark fuscous.
